BobKat Basketball Returns: A New Season, Fresh Talent, and Championship Aspirations

Saturday, March 1, the Kokomo BobKats will tip off their fifth season. The BobKats have captivated basketball fans in the City of Firsts, satisfying their itch to watch the game they love.

The atmosphere during BobKats games is often described as electric, with the DJ, drumline, and dancers helping keep the energy high throughout.

This year, the BobKats will play home games inside Kokomo High School’s Hayworth Gymnasium. The intimate venue will continue to foster the energy that gives the BobKats one of the best home-court advantages in The Basketball League.

Chandler Levingston Simon returns for his second year as head coach of the Kokomo BobKats. The son of the first BobKats head coach, Cliff Levingston, Levingston Simon’s experience with the team gives him a clear understanding of what it takes to lead the BobKats to success.

The BobKats open their season Saturday, March 1, against the Lake County Legacy. The game tips off at 7:05 p.m. and will be played at Kokomo High School’s Hayworth Gymnasium.
